How to prepare for a job interview at Costa Limited
✨Know Your Coffee
Familiarise yourself with different coffee types and brewing methods. Being able to discuss your favourite coffee or share a fun fact about espresso can show your passion for the role and impress the interviewers.
✨Showcase Your Customer Service Skills
Prepare examples of how you've provided excellent customer service in the past. Think about times when you turned a negative experience into a positive one, as this will highlight your adaptability and resourcefulness.
✨Teamwork is Key
Costa values collaboration, so be ready to discuss your experiences working in a team. Share specific instances where you contributed to a group effort or helped resolve a conflict, demonstrating your communication skills.
